    Simmons when Embiid is out/inactive (vs regular season average):

    2020-2021 (16 games):
    15.5 ppg (14.3)
    8 rpg (7.2)
    6.6 apg (6.9)
    4.25 TOpg (3.0)
    48.7% FG% (55.7%)
    50.9% FT% (61.3%)
    W-L: 7-9

    2019-2020 (16 games):
    20 ppg (16.4)
    8 rpg (7.8)
    7.1 apg (8.0)
    3.1 TOpg (3.3)
    61.4% FG% (58%)
    68.2% FT% (62%)
    W-L: 9-7

    2018-2019 (17 games):
    19 ppg (16.9)
    10.1 rpg (8.8)
    7 apg (7.7)
    3.8 TOpg (3.5)
    55.6 FG% (56.3%)
    68.1 FT% (60%)
    W-L: 7-10

    2017-2018 (18 games):
    16.2 ppg (15.8)
    9.1 rpg (9.1)
    8.4 apg (8.2)
    3.9 TOpg (3.4)
    56% FG% (54.5%)
    55.4% FT% (56%)
    W-L: 11-7

    According to fivethirtyeight.com's stats (specifically their proprietary RAPTOR stats) last year:

    Ben Simmons ranked 4th on the team in Defensive Box Score RAPTOR, behind Thybulle, Embiid and Green
    Ben Simmons tied for 5th on the team in Total Box Score RAPTOR, behind Embiid, Thybulle, Green, Korkmaz and tied with Harris
    Ben Simmons tied for 3rd on the team in Defensive On/Off RAPTOR, behind Korkmaz, Thybulle and tied with Embiid
    Ben Simmons was 5th on the team in Overall RAPTOR score, ahead of Harris but behind Korkmaz.
    Ben Simmons did, however, rank 3rd in WAR behind Embiid and Danny Green

    Overall, last year:

    Ben Simmons' Defensive Box Score RAPTOR score (+2.0) had him tied with OG Anunoby, Deandre Ayton, Jokic, and current Rocket Daniel Theis.
    Ben Simmons' Defensive On/Off RAPTOR score (+2.2) did have him tied with Embiid with both right behind LeBron James in 40th place
    Overall, Simmons' overall RAPTOR score (+2.2) had him tied with Michael Porter Jr, Trae Young and Bam Adebayo for 63rd place.
    Simmons' WAR score (4.7) has him tied with Jaylen Brown and TJ McConnell at 51st place.

    Simmons' WAR score since 2017:

    2017-2018: 9.0
    2018-2019: 3.0 (I'll let his defenders blame Butler on this one)
    2019-2020: 5.3
    2020-2021: 4.7
